Who is Carmen?

Carmen is a supporting character in Gilbert Hernandez's Palomar stories, inhabiting the same richly drawn Latin American community as Luba and Penny Century. She is one of many vividly realized residents whose personal life and relationships form part of Hernandez's interconnected ensemble narrative.

Stepping out of the sun-drenched pages of Gilbert Hernandez's landmark Love and Rockets in 1983, Carmen is a Bronze Age original woven into one of alternative comics' most celebrated and enduring tapestries. Over the course of more than three decades, she moves through the richly imagined world Hernandez built at Fantagraphics, sharing her story across Love and Rockets, Love and Rockets: New Stories, and Love and Rockets Bonanza! β€” keeping vivid company with the likes of Luba, Penny Century, and Chelo along the way. Two of her appearances carry key-issue weight, a testament to the significance of the moments she inhabits in this beloved series.
